Transaction 59755db31ebcd261e1ee2f5d6c71b56fd718c86a81449defff1236c3a42b998a
1 Input
1 Output
-
59755db31ebcd261e1ee2f5d6c71b56fd718c86a81449defff1236c3a42b998a:0
- value
- 1830863
- script pubkey
- OP_0 OP_PUSHBYTES_20 df58b2bb82bd96537c83b4ff4981dbead2fd92e8
- address
- bc1qmavt9wuzhkt9xlyrknl5nqwmatf0myhgrj8z5u